BLACKPINK’s Pop-up Store to Open in Seoul on Thursday

Get ready, BLINKs! BLACKPINK’s highly anticipated pop-up store is set to open in Seoul this Thursday. Ever since the BORNPINK Finale in Seoul, fans have been trying to get their hands on the tickets and merch. To celebrate BORNPINK Finale in Seoul, a pop-up store is set to open on Thursday Seoul’s Hongdae area.

YG Plus, subsidiary of YG Entertainment, announced that the BORNPINK Pop-up Experience in Seoul would open for a four-day run, from September 14 to 17. BLINKs can purchase the official merchandise from the store.

The pop-up store will sell hoodies, caps, t-shirts, and other accessories designed in collaboration with the Japanese designer, Verdy. These pop-up stores were previously opened in many cities where the BLACKPINK members toured. 

These limited-edition goods sell out quickly as thousands of fans want to attend the concert donning the official merch. Moreover, the BLACKPINK pop-up store in Seoul would also sell the hottest selling goods, for instance, the BLACKPINK electric bicycle. That’s not all, BLINKs can take selfies and photos in the photo booth installed at the pop-up store.


BLACKPINK is set to wrap up their ongoing BORNPINK tour with two shows in Seoul. These shows will be held at Seoul’s Gocheok Sky Dome from Saturday to Sunday (16 & 17 September).
